Why Is My Oil Yield Dropping? A Diagnostic Checklist for Hydraulic Press Operators

When a press that used to run well starts giving less oil, the cause is almost always one of a handful of things. Here is the checklist, in the order worth checking, from free fixes to the few that need a part.

A hydraulic press that used to fill the barrel and run dry cake suddenly leaving more oil behind is one of the most common calls we get. The good news: yield loss almost always traces back to a short list of causes, and most of them cost nothing to fix. The trick is to check them in the right order — material and process first, machine last — so you do not replace a seal when the real problem was a cool press or wet seed. Here is that checklist.

Start with the material, not the machine

Before you touch the press, look at what goes into it. Most sudden yield drops are a material or preparation change, not a mechanical fault — and these cost nothing to correct.

  • Moisture — seed that is too wet or too dry both press badly. There is a sweet spot for each oilseed; a new batch at the wrong moisture is the most common culprit.
  • Particle size — under-crushed material does not release oil; over-crushed can pack and block drainage. Check the crusher and pre-press stage.
  • Temperature (hot press) — if you hot-press, under-heated seed gives noticeably less oil. Confirm the cooking / roasting stage is hitting its usual temperature.
  • New seed source or season — a different lot, origin or crop year can simply have lower oil content. Rule this out before blaming the press.

Then check the pressing process

If the material is right, look at how you are pressing. Rushing the cycle is a quiet yield killer on a hydraulic batch press.

  • Hold time — hydraulic pressing needs the pressure held so oil keeps flowing. Releasing too early leaves oil in the cake. Compare your current cycle against how you used to run it.
  • Barrel charge — over- or under-filling the barrel changes how evenly pressure reaches the cake. Keep to the charge that worked before.
  • Separator plates — our presses use carbon-steel separator plates between cake layers. If they are scored, bent or out of flat, pressure spreads unevenly and oil is left behind. Inspect and re-flatten or replace as needed.

Then check working pressure

Only after material and process check out should you suspect the machine is not reaching full pressure. Read this off the gauges — and this is exactly why our presses carry two.

What you see Likely cause What to do
Both gauges read low Worn cylinder seals or tired hydraulic oil Inspect/replace the seal kit; change oil + filter if overdue
The two gauges disagree A sticking gauge, or the relief valve not holding pressure Cross-check and replace the faulty gauge; check the high/low-pressure relief valve relieves at the right setting
Pressure builds then bleeds off High/low-pressure relief valve or seals passing Check the mechanical relief valve setting; inspect seals for leak-by
Oil weeping around the ram Cylinder seals worn Replace the seal kit
Use the two-gauge readout to separate a pressure fault from a material or process problem.

The check order, at a glance

Work down this list and stop at the first thing that is off. Going in order keeps you from replacing parts to fix what was really a wet batch or a short hold time.

  • 1. Material — moisture, particle size, heat (hot press), seed source
  • 2. Process — hold time, barrel charge, separator plate condition
  • 3. Pressure — both gauges reading full and in agreement
  • 4. Parts — cylinder seals, hydraulic oil + filter, relief valve setting

Most of the time the answer is in the first two steps and costs nothing. If you have worked down to parts, keep a cylinder seal kit and a filter element on the shelf so the fix is a planned half-day, not days of downtime.

FAQ

My yield dropped suddenly. What is the most likely cause?

A material or process change, not the machine. Check seed moisture, particle size, hot-press temperature and your pressing hold time first — these explain most sudden drops and cost nothing to correct.

How do I know if the press is not reaching full pressure?

Read the two gauges. If both read low, suspect worn cylinder seals or tired hydraulic oil. If they disagree, you likely have a sticking gauge or a relief valve not holding. Equal needles at the normal reading mean pressure is fine and the problem is elsewhere.

Can worn separator plates lower yield?

Yes. The carbon-steel separator plates between cake layers must stay flat and unscored so pressure spreads evenly. Bent or scored plates leave oil in the cake. Inspect them and re-flatten or replace as needed.

Does old hydraulic oil reduce oil yield?

It can. Degraded oil and a clogged filter lower the pressure the cylinder can reach, which leaves oil in the cake. If the oil change is overdue, change it along with the filter element before chasing other causes.

When should I replace the cylinder seals?

When pressure has drifted below where it used to sit, or you see oil weeping around the ram. Seals are an inexpensive wear part; keeping a kit on the shelf turns this into a planned half-day job.
